Problem
Traditional surveys and forms often result in low engagement and response rates, hindering the ability of businesses to gather comprehensive and insightful user feedback. Analyzing unstructured feedback from user research can be time-consuming, delaying product development and decision-making processes.
Solution
Telepace provides an AI-powered platform that transforms standard surveys into engaging, personalized conversations, significantly increasing response rates. The platform uses intelligent follow-up questions to delve deeper into user feedback, mimicking the depth of information obtained through one-on-one interviews. Telepace then employs AI to automatically cluster feedback into key themes, such as bugs, onboarding issues, or feature requests, and quantifies these themes to highlight the areas impacting users most. This structured analysis enables businesses to uncover actionable insights from user feedback in hours rather than weeks.

Features
- AI-driven conversational surveys that adapt to user responses in real-time
- Automated clustering of user feedback into key themes with quantified impact analysis
- Sentiment analysis to gauge user satisfaction and identify areas for improvement
- Customizable survey templates and AI-generated question suggestions
- Integration capabilities for distributing surveys via links, emails, or in-app
- Interactive reports that visualize user feedback and highlight key insights
- Multi-language support to engage with customers in their native languages
